Qualcomm Quick Charge 2.0 for UK Z3C?
Can some-one give a definitive answer as to whether an Xperia Z3 Compact purchased in the UK is quick charge 2.0 enabled before I buy a QC charger for it? According to the Qualcom website both the Z2, Z3 and Z3C are QC 2.0 capable, however checking through this forum it appears that only the Japanese variant of the Z2 and Z3 actually have QC 2.0, is this the same for the Z3C? Thanks
Sorry for the late reply.
Yes, it does support Quick Charge 2.0 over the magnetic connector but the magnetic charging dock must also support Quick Charge 2.0. Our DK48 supports it.

We forwarded this internally for more information some time ago and the information i got is that Z3 Compact does support Quick Charge 2.0. The following Xperia devices supports Quick Charge 2.0:
Xperia™ Z3 Compact
Xperia™ Z3 Tablet Compact
Xperia™ Z2 Tablet
Xperia™ Z3 (only Japanese variants SO-01G, SOL26 and 401SO)
Xperia™ Z2 (only Japanese variant SO-03F)
Of our docking stations, only DK48 supports it.
But i don't have any Quick Charge 2.0 charger so i haven't been able to test how much faster it will charge. -
Sony Quick Charge 2.0 UCH-10
Hello, can i use the UCH-10 Quick Carger 2.0 for the Sony Xperia Z4 Tablet LTE ? And is the charger faster than the normal charger?Or is Sony planning to sell a special Quick charger for the Xperia Z4 Tablet?
Hi,
The UCH10 is a charger for devices that supports Qualcomm Quick Charge 2.0 standard (which Xperia Z4 Tablet does). So yes, it will work and also charge your Tablet faster.
Note that you should always use the UCB11 cable which is included with the charger at purchase. -
